São Miguel is the largest island in the archipelago, 62.1 km long and 15.8 km wide. As one of the 7 Natural Wonders of Portugal, the Green and Blue Lagoons are the ex-libris of our island, which according to legend, were formed from the tears of a shepherd and a princess who shared a forbidden love.
This tour takes you around the crater of the volcano of Sete Cidades, with breathtaking views of the lagoons and sea. Experience an off-road adventure that will offer thrilling and adrenaline filled moments.

Sao Miguel, the largest island in the Azores archipelago, is renowned for its lush landscapes, hot springs, and dramatic volcanic features. With its mild climate, stunning natural beauty, and rich cultural heritage, it offers a unique blend of relaxation and adventure.

Pico Island is known for its dramatic landscapes, including Mount Pico, Portugal's highest peak, and its vineyards, which are a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
Faial Island is known for its beautiful landscapes, including the Horta harbor and the Capelinhos Volcano, as well as its rich maritime history.
Santa Maria Island is known for its beautiful beaches, clear waters, and lush landscapes, making it a great destination for relaxation and outdoor activities.
